ABSTRACT:
Oligonucleotide molecules for the detection ofGiardia lamblia(G. lambliawhich molecules hybridise under medium to high stringency conditions to unique 18S rDNA/rRNA sequences ofG. lamblia,and methods for the detection of the presence of viable cells ofG. lambliain samples using the oligonucleotide molecules.
